ENGINE AND ENGINE COOLING

Defect SummaryCertain motorcycles, a significant quantity of oil lubricant can leak on to the rear wheel and tire from the oil cooler.
Consequence SummaryOil leakage can cause dangerous riding conditions which could lead to injury or a crash.
Corrective SummaryDealers will inspect the oil cooler and replace it if necessary. the recall began on december 5, 2004. owners should contact ducati at 408-343-4411.

SERVICE BRAKES, HYDRAULIC

Defect SummaryCertain crg front brake levers, model rb-511 designed for use on 2004-2006 yamaha yzf-r1 motorcycles, and 2005-2006 yamaha yzf-r6 motorcycles. model rb-512 is designed for use on 2003-2006 ducati 749 and 999 motorcycles, and on 2004-2006 aprilia mille r motorcycles. due to a misalignment of the pivot bore, the brake lever could become seized in the brake engaged position, thereby preventing the front brake from disengaging.
Consequence SummaryA non-release condition could cause drag on the front brake system, which could possibly result in a vehicle crash.
Corrective SummaryCrg will notify owners and replace the rocker for the front lever free of charge. the recall is expected to begin during may 2006. owners may concact crg at 831-763-7811.
NotesThis recall only pertains to aftermarket crg front brake levers and has no relation to any original equipment installed on motorcycles manufactured by yamaha, ducati, or aprilia.customers may contact the national highway traffic safety administration's vehicle safety hotline at 1-888-327-4236 (tty: 1-800-424-9153); or go to http://www.safercar.gov.
SERVICE BRAKES, HYDRAULIC - FOUNDATION COMPONENTS - HOSES, LINES/PIPING, AND FITTINGS

Defect SummaryOn certain motorcycles, the front brake hose can become trapped between the lower steering flange and the steering lock peg when the vehicle is cornering.
Consequence SummaryThis condition could cause a loss of front brake fluid pressure and damage to the brake hose, which could rupture causing front brake failure. this could result in a crash.
Corrective SummaryDealers will install a retaining clip on the front brake hose. the recall is expected to begin during december 2004. owners should contact ducati at 1-408-253-0499.
